Worked Example
Verified calculation
Given:
- heat_rate = 500
- area = 2
Expected Result:
- heat_flux = 250

Formula / Method
heat_flux = heat_rate / areaFormula family: family_heat_flu
Variables
| Symbol | Label | Role | Description |
|---|---|---|---|
| heat_rate | Heat rate | INPUT | Heat rate |
| area | Area | INPUT | Area |
| heat_flux | Heat flux | OUTPUT | Heat flux |
Calculation Steps
- Enter the heat rate in W.
- Enter the area in m².
- Step 1: Compute heat flux.
- Read the heat flux (W/m²) from the results.
